Genoa Area hasn't had much luck against Northview recently, but that could start to change on Monday. The Comets will venture away from home to take on the Wildcats at 7:15 p.m. Genoa Area is coming into the game hot, having won their last eight games.
Genoa Area proved they can win big on Tuesday (they won by 35) and on Thursday they proved they can win the close ones too. They skirted past Start 35-32. The 35-point effort marked the Comets' lowest-scoring contest of the season, but in the end it didn't matter.
Meanwhile, it was a proper cat-fight when Northview duked it out with Whitmer on Thursday. The Wildcats walked away with a 49-38 victory over the Panthers. Given the Wildcats' advantage in MaxPreps' Ohio basketball rankings (they are ranked 73rd, while the Panthers are ranked 235th) , the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Genoa Area's record now sits at 11-3. As for Northview, their record is now 11-2.
Genoa Area came up short against Northview when the teams last played back in January of 2025, falling 52-42. Can the Comets av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
